[Mesa-dev] [PATCH 18/21] i965/fs: Allow specifying arbitrary execution sizes up to 32 to FIND_LIVE_CHANNEL.

Francisco Jerez currojerez at riseup.net
Tue May 24 07:18:55 UTC 2016


Due to a Gen7-specific hardware bug native 32-wide instructions get
the lower 16 bits of the execution mask applied incorrectly to both
halves of the instruction, so the MOV trick we currently use wouldn't
work.  Instead emit multiple 16-wide MOV instructions in 32-wide mode
in order to cover the whole execution mask.

diff --git a/src/mesa/drivers/dri/i965/brw_eu_emit.c b/src/mesa/drivers/dri/i965/brw_eu_emit.c
index af7caed..d36877c 100644
--- a/src/mesa/drivers/dri/i965/brw_eu_emit.c
+++ b/src/mesa/drivers/dri/i965/brw_eu_emit.c
@@ -3330,6 +3330,7 @@ void
 brw_find_live_channel(struct brw_codegen *p, struct brw_reg dst)
 {
    const struct brw_device_info *devinfo = p->devinfo;
+   const unsigned exec_size = 1 << brw_inst_exec_size(devinfo, p->current);
    brw_inst *inst;
 
    assert(devinfo->gen >= 7);
@@ -3359,15 +3360,23 @@ brw_find_live_channel(struct brw_codegen *p, struct brw_reg dst)
 
          brw_MOV(p, flag, brw_imm_ud(0));
 
-         /* Run a 16-wide instruction returning zero with execution masking
-          * and a conditional modifier enabled in order to get the current
-          * execution mask in f1.0.
+         /* Run enough instructions returning zero with execution masking and
+          * a conditional modifier enabled in order to get the full execution
+          * mask in f1.0.  We could use a single 32-wide move here if it
+          * weren't because of the hardware bug that causes channel enables to
+          * be applied incorrectly to the second half of 32-wide instructions
+          * on Gen7.
           */
-         inst = brw_MOV(p, brw_null_reg(), brw_imm_ud(0));
-         brw_inst_set_exec_size(devinfo, inst, BRW_EXECUTE_16);
-         brw_inst_set_mask_control(devinfo, inst, BRW_MASK_ENABLE);
-         brw_inst_set_cond_modifier(devinfo, inst, BRW_CONDITIONAL_Z);
-         brw_inst_set_flag_reg_nr(devinfo, inst, 1);
+         const unsigned lower_size = MIN2(16, exec_size);
+         for (unsigned i = 0; i < exec_size / lower_size; i++) {
+            inst = brw_MOV(p, retype(brw_null_reg(), BRW_REGISTER_TYPE_UW),
+                           brw_imm_uw(0));
+            brw_inst_set_mask_control(devinfo, inst, BRW_MASK_ENABLE);
+            brw_inst_set_group(devinfo, inst, lower_size * i);
+            brw_inst_set_cond_modifier(devinfo, inst, BRW_CONDITIONAL_Z);
+            brw_inst_set_flag_reg_nr(devinfo, inst, 1);
+            brw_inst_set_exec_size(devinfo, inst, cvt(lower_size) - 1);
+         }
 
          brw_FBL(p, vec1(dst), flag);
       }
